Tower falls to reported loss as large event costs rise to $55.6m for FY23

Kiwi insurer Tower has reported a net loss for the year ended September 30 2023, as the firm’s combined ratio deteriorated by more than 10 percentage points on the back of an elevated catastrophe loss experience. For the year to 30 September 2023, the insurer recorded an underlying profit incl...
